Immediate Effect On Workflow

When a business enters into administration, the prompt effect on its operations can be considerable, affecting various elements of its functioning. One of the key effects is the interruption in everyday tasks. With unpredictability surrounding the future of the firm, staff members may experience distress, resulting in lowered efficiency and motivation. Furthermore, distributors and partners might become hesitant to involve with business, affecting the supply chain and potentially creating delays or lacks in essential resources.

Financially, the company may face restrictions on its costs and financial investment choices, as administrators take control to examine the circumstance and figure out the very best program of action. This can result in capital challenges, making it tough to satisfy responsibilities such as paying salaries or working out invoices without delay. Additionally, the reputation of business may endure, as information of management spreads, potentially leading to a loss of client depend on and loyalty.

Financial Implications for Stakeholders

The immediate operational challenges encountered by a business entering administration have significant economic implications for stakeholders involved in the company's events. Investors typically bear the brunt of monetary losses, experiencing a decline in the worth of their financial investments as the company's supply prices plummet. Staff members deal with uncertainties concerning their salaries, benefits, and job security, with prospective layoffs or minimized compensation bundles looming. Distributors might encounter settlement delays and even non-payment for items or solutions offered, influencing their capital and general security. Furthermore, financial institutions deal with the threat of receiving just a portion of the cash owed to them, causing potential losses and impacting their very own economic health. On the various other hand, consumers may also be affected by a service entering into administration, encountering disruptions in service, service warranty issues, or the loss of pre-paid solutions or down payments. These financial implications highlight the causal sequence that a service getting in administration can carry different stakeholders, emphasizing the significance of positive threat management and calculated preparation.



Lawful Responsibilities and Obligations

Navigating the elaborate web of lawful responsibilities and responsibilities is an important endeavor for all events entailed when a service enters management. The administrators selected to supervise the procedure have a task to act in the best passions of the creditors. They have to conform with lawful needs, such as preparing reports on the firm's financial scenario and conducting conferences with creditors to review the administration procedure.

Staff members also have lawful rights that have to be supported throughout administration. Depending upon the conditions, they may be qualified to redundancy pay, notification pay, and other benefits. It is crucial for administrators to adhere to employment laws and make sure that workers are dealt with relatively throughout the procedure.

Financial institutions play a considerable duty in administration as well. They can what happens to employees when a company goes into liquidation be notified concerning the firm's economic standing, attend creditors' meetings, and vote on vital choices. Administrators have to communicate transparently with creditors and follow legal procedures to safeguard their rate of interests.
